Birch floor installation services involve the professional placement of birch wood flooring in residential properties. These projects typically include laying new birch flooring in living rooms, bedrooms, hallways, or other interior spaces, as well as replacing existing flooring with fresh birch planks. Homeowners often seek this service to enhance the aesthetic appeal of their interiors, improve durability, or update the style of their home’s flooring. Before requesting installation, property owners usually want to understand the different types of birch flooring available, such as solid or engineered options, and how each may suit their specific needs and lifestyle.
Property owners considering birch flooring installation should also evaluate factors like the condition of the subfloor, the level of foot traffic in the area, and the desired finish or stain. It’s important to consider the overall design and how birch’s natural light tone complements existing decor. Clarifying these details can help ensure the chosen flooring meets expectations for appearance, longevity, and maintenance. Proper planning and understanding of these elements can contribute to a smooth installation process and a satisfying final result.

Birch Floor Installation Questions
What types of flooring materials are suitable for Birch floor installation? Birch flooring can be installed over various subfloors, including concrete, plywood, and existing wood surfaces, making it versatile for different properties.
Is it necessary to prepare the subfloor before installing Birch flooring? Yes, the subfloor should be clean, dry, and level to ensure proper installation and long-lasting results.
Can Birch flooring be installed in high-moisture areas? Birch is best suited for areas with stable humidity levels; excessive moisture can affect its durability and appearance.
